New Westside Bus Route

Getting to Millennium Park just got a whole lot easier. Starting tomorrow, The Rapid is rolling out a new weekend route called Route 1000 to boost bus service on the Westside. The route runs from Rapid Central Station and hits 36 stops through the Westside, ending at Millennium Park. This is the first time The Rapid has served the park since 2005, giving residents an easy ride to trails, water, and sunshine. | Learn more about the new route

Progress Update: Children’s Hospital

Grand Rapids just hit a major milestone in building Michigan’s first-ever children’s rehabilitation hospital. The final steel beam was placed this week on the Joan Secchia Children’s Rehabilitation Hospital — a $70 million project from Mary Free Bed and Helen DeVos Children’s Hospital. The building will serve kids from across the country who need intensive rehab care, while featuring inpatient and outpatient gyms, a family resource center, and a skybridge connecting to the current facility. | Ribbon-cutting is expected in 2025

Wood Waste Becomes Clean Energy

A new $2M facility in Grand Rapids is turning wood waste into power. Woodchuck, a climate start-up, just opened Michigan’s first electric-powered biomass center. Using AI, it sorts and processes scrap wood into clean fuel—cutting landfill waste and helping power homes and businesses. The project has already created 14 local jobs and partners with the city to process downed trees for free. | Read more about this innovative company

River Bank Run Returns

Courtesy of Amway River Bank Run

One of the biggest race weekends of the year is back in downtown Grand Rapids.

The 48th annual Amway River Bank Run kicks off tomorrow morning — and whether you’re running or not, you’ll want to plan ahead.

Over 10,000 participants are expected across multiple events, including the country’s largest 25K and the world’s only 25K wheelchair race.

And road closures start today around 3 PM on Monroe Ave (between Michigan and Louis) and Saturday at 3 AM on Ottawa Ave (between Michigan and Fulton). So if you’re heading downtown, check out this report for the full set of closures.

đŸŽČ đŸ” Board Games and Breakfast

A new board game cafĂ© is coming to the Creston neighborhood. Kobold’s Kitchen will take over the old Fat Boy on Plainfield in August. It offers classic breakfast, burgers, coffee, and a massive library of 800+ board games, creating a family-friendly spot where you can grab a bite, play a quick game, or unplug with the kids.
